About The Position

University Development and Alumni Relations (UDAR) is dedicated to soliciting the private funding necessary to support the strategic goals of the University in teaching, learning, and research. The personnel of UDAR work university-wide as well as within individual schools and colleges of the University to discover, motivate, cultivate, solicit, and steward alumni, parents, faculty, and friends for immediate, long-range, and future financial support, through gifts and pledges to the University, for critical operations such as student aid, faculty support, academic and research program development, and facilities and infrastructure. UDAR's endeavors raise funds for immediate University use and also for the University's endowment. The Director of Development, Strategic Engagement for Arts & Science (A&S) will serve as a conduit of information and strategy between A&S leadership, University offices, and the development team to advance the collaborative effort of moving transformational gifts forward. Maintain a current, deep knowledge of the strategic goals and funding priorities of A&S to align opportunities for support with donor goals. Work closely with School leadership and faculty to identify interdisciplinary and multi-layer opportunities including but not limited to facility, personnel, student, and programmatic support. Provide strategic leadership for the development of meaningful engagement opportunities for donor cultivation, engagement, and stewardship. Ensure information flows seamlessly between academic and administrative partners as their deep knowledge will be shared with the development team to help create and present individualized, compelling proposals to prospective donors accompanied by sustainable stewardship strategies. Manage a robust dataset of A&S projects, donor prospects, timelines, giving projections, and strategies for the Arts & Science campaign. Supervise development team members.
